## Authentication

Welcome to the GreenLoop controller repo! Before you can poke at the sensor drift calibration endpoints, you'll need to authenticate against the HazelVale hub. Drift correction runs hourly, and the humidity probes in Bay 3 are notorious for wandering, so you'll be hitting these APIs a lot. Grab your credentials from the team vault, then pass them with every calibration request. All requests go over TLS, no exceptions. Use the following bearer token for local testing:

portal login ticket: eyJhbGciOiJIUzI1NiIsInR5cCI6IkpXVCJ9.eyJzdWIiOiIwEOsktwVNwIn0.-UJU3fdyyCgG

**Audit item 14: string extraction script.** Heads up, future maintainers — the `lex-harvest` script that pulls translatable strings out of the Fernwood UI still chokes on nested template literals. We patched around it for the Quillon release, but the fix is duct tape. Verify extraction output against the canonical catalog before every locale drop, and log any mismatch in the audit sheet. Questions about the workaround should go to the current owner.

approver of yawig-yajef = Briius Jorix

## Thumbnail Queue — Data Stores

The Pixelforge thumbnail queue runs on a dedicated Postgres instance, separate from the main asset DB. Jobs land in `thumb_jobs`, workers claim rows with `FOR UPDATE SKIP LOCKED`, and completed entries purge after 48 hours. Don't touch indexes without pinging the Render team. To inspect the queue locally, connect using the string below.

database URL for tajog-bajeg: mysql://soreth_svc:OzsCjhu@db-6997.nelvrostack.internal:5432/kelax

## Log compaction contacts — Ferrostream

Release managers: before cutting a release, confirm the Ferrostream compactor is idle — shipping mid-compaction can leave half-merged segments that make rollbacks painful. The compaction schedule lives on the Ferrostream ops calendar; it usually runs nightly but can be paused with a flag in the broker config. If you need a compaction window moved, or you're seeing retention anomalies after a deploy, the broker platform squad owns this end to end. Don't guess — just ask. Their shared inbox is below.

escalation mailbox, bafog-fafog: ulador@paliqlabs.internal